While I can appreciate your reference to consequential ethics, there are many strengths and weakness to consequentialism. In this case study, it is understandable there are potential consequences to allowing and acute stroke patient return to home without an adequate support system. The patient may not be able to take care of herself properly and provide the basic necessities of life. According to Pozgar (2016), based on the view that the value of an action derives solely from the value of its consequences…the goal of a consequentialist is to achieve the great good for the greatest number (p. 38).
